Rogers boys fall to Centennial 5-4

The Centennial Cougars (10-4-2) came to Rogers on Jan. 20 for a showdown between two of the top teams in the Northwest Suburban conference. Both teams entered the contest trailing league leader Maple Grove by just a point in the standings. After a scoreless first period, Rogers (11-5-2) would open the scoring at 2:40 of the second when senior Mason Wanka took a centering pass from Drew Krekelberg and beat the Cougars goalie for a 1-0 Rogers lead.
